Washington (CNN)Former Vice President Joe Biden has taken the lead in his birth state of Pennsylvania as the number of outstanding ballots has dwindled, putting the Democrat within striking distance of the 270 electoral votes that he needs to win the White House.

CNN has not yet called the commonwealth for the former vice president, but for Biden -- a son of Scranton -- eclipsing Trump in the Keystone State was a symbolic moment in the course of a political career that has spanned nearly five decades.
With the latest batch of tabulated vote counts released Friday morning, Biden now has a lead of 5,587 votes in the state.
During the long and hard-fought primary Democratic primary, Biden repeatedly made the case that he alone could sway the blue-collar voters who abandoned his party to support Donald Trump in 2016 and could rebuild the Democrats' "blue wall" in the Midwest that Trump had demolished.
